About The Role
As an Analyst, Health and Benefits Consulting, you’ll build a deep understanding of the group benefits landscape while supporting one of our largest regions in Canada. In this role, you’ll work within our Renewals team and partner closely with Employee Benefits professionals to ensure our clients receive timely, accurate and meaningful support.

Your days will vary. You’ll respond to client questions, analyze plan data, and prepare renewal and reporting deliverables that guide decision making. You’ll collaborate directly with regional consultants and the broader analytical team to interpret trends, identify opportunities and keep client programs running smoothly.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ys digging into the numbers but also understands the importance of clear communication and strong client service.


What You’ll Do

  • Provide direct day-to-day problem solving support for clients in relation to their group benefits programs

  • Perform data entry to support quarterly and annual financial analysis for a broad range of clients in a variety of industry sectors

  • Conduct renewal analyses, negotiate fees and rates with carriers – in alignment with department strategy

  • Prepare client ready renewal reports in PowerPoint

  • Review insurance contracts and financial statements

  • Support the consultants in managing projects, conducting or directing research, and drawing meaningful conclusions from client and market data

  • Gain insight and build knowledge of our organization, its services, people and purpose

  • Data review, assumption setting, and report writing for actuarial valuations (actuarial track only)

  • Handle confidential information and data – adhering to HUB’s privacy and confidentiality agreement


What You’ll Need for Success

  • Post-secondary degrees in Commerce, Mathematics, Actuarial Sciences, or Human Resources

  • 1-2 years of professional experience as an analyst or in a corporate setting, with employee benefits experience being a valuable asset.

  • Completion of courses related to Group Benefits (e.g. Certified Employee Benefits Specialist – CEBS, insurance license, and actuarial designation) are not required, but would be an asset

  • LLQP certification is considered an asset; candidates without it must be willing to complete it within the first year of employment.

  • Advanced Proficiency in MS Office: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ook

  • PowerBI experience an asset

  • Excellent communication, project management, and collaboration skills

  • Experience working in a high-paced, growth environment

Compensation

The expected salary range for this position is $55,000 to $60,000 and will be impacted by factors such as the successful candidate’s skills, experience and working location, as well as the specific position’s business line, scope and level.

HUB International is proud to offer comprehensive benefit and total compensation packages which could include extended health benefits, disability insurance, RRSP matching, paid-time-off benefits, and eligible bonuses, and commissions for some positions.
